]]>I’m having an intermittent issue with The Events Calendar whereby sometimes the buttons to change view between Month, Day and List simply don’t respond. When this happens, navigating between pages using the arrows or using the drop down calendar navigator also don’t work.
Sometimes page refreshes work, sometimes they don’t. I’ve cleared browser caches and sometimes the fault is still there.
I’ve disabled all other plugins, activated default theme Twenty Twenty and the issue still crops up from time to time.
Running:
WordPress 6.2.2
The Events Calendar 6.0.13.1
PHP 8.0.28
Tested with Chrome 113.0.5672.127, Firefox 13.0.5672.127 and Edge 113.0.1774.50. The issue is intermittent in all of them.
EDIT: Okay, so I’ve found that the difference appears to be that it works if it has the “www.” in the website but not without it.
So https://www.rakiuracalendar.com works great whereas https://rakiuracalendar.com doesn’t.
